A Study On Elementary And Intermediate Foreign Students' Acquisition Of Chinese Rhetorical Questions

Chinese rhetorical question is a type of sentence which indicates either positive or negative meanings by asking a question. The following four patterns of Chinese interrogative sentences can be used as rhetorical questions which were yes-no questions, specially related questions, positive-negative questions and alternative questions. According to the different frequencies appear within the particular language circumstances, yes-no questions and specially related questions are being used more frequently than the others. The rhetorical question is characterized as the contrary between its form and meaning, which means the positive pattern expresses the negative meaning and the negative form refers the positive meaning. Due to the particular expression function of the Chinese rhetorical question, it could reflect the specific mood and emotional within the different communicational language environments. That is quite difficult for those foreign students who lack of the language sense. It could present various kinds of errors. Therefore, this seems to be one of the difficulties for teaching Chinese as a second language.This article is built on the basis of researching the Chinese rhetorical questions. From the perspective of the second language acquisition, associate with using the questionnaire surveys and quantitative statistics, it could help to understand the various errors while the foreign students studying and utilizing the Chinese rhetorical questions. For understanding the reasons and species of the errors, it requires emphasizing the aspects of understanding and operation capability. According to these, refers that relative suggestion particularly on the problems which exist within the current teaching materials and the Chinese rhetorical questions teaching. Thus could helps to provide the theoretical and practical references for the teaching.The article is composed of four chapters. For the preface, it generally states the current researching achievements for Chinese rhetorical questions, and then reveals the purpose, significance, contents, and method of the study. For the second chapter, specific for the elementary and intermediate foreign students' acquisition, it mainly illustrates the design and implementation of questionnaire surveys, the quantitative statistical analysis and the report of the survey results. For the third chapter is the suggestion about the Chinese rhetorical questions teaching. It provides some recommendations for the teaching materials and methods on the basis of the reasons and the species of the errors. For the last chapter, it is the conclusion in related to the aspects of the innovative and the inadequate within this study.
